Melvin Breeden

November 22, 1944 — February 12, 2025

Melvin Breeden, 80, passed away on February 12, 2025. He was born in Indianapolis on November 22, 1944.

A proud Army veteran, Melvin served from 1963 to 1966, honoring his country with dedication and courage. His commitment to service shaped his character and was a source of pride for his family and friends.

He retired after many dedicated years of service from Allison’s Transmissions and Rolls Royce.

Melvin’s love for the outdoors was evident in his many hobbies. He was an avid boater and fisherman, spending countless hours on the water, enjoying the serenity and thrill of both. Riding motorcycles was another passion, and Melvin could often be found cruising the open roads with a smile on his face.

He especially loved planting a vegetable garden every summer, filling his home with the bounty of fresh produce. Wherever Melvin lived, he always made sure to plant fruit trees—pear, apple, or cherry—creating lasting memories with each harvest and sharing the fruits of his labor with those he loved. 

In addition to his outdoor pursuits, Melvin was known for his competitive spirit and love of games. He was a skilled player of penny poker, as well as card games like Euchre and 5 Crowns, and he cherished the time spent around the table with his family and friends. His sense of humor, laughter, and gentle nature will be greatly missed by all who knew him.

Melvin was a loving father, grandfather, great grandfather, brother, nephew, cousin, and friend. He was deeply devoted to his family. He will be remembered for his warmth, kindness, and the joy he brought to those around him. His legacy of love will live on in the hearts of his family and friends.
